Ordinals
beta
Sat 727965712374975
decimal
145593.712374975
degree
0°145593′441″712374975‴
percentile
34.66503396074941%
name
irrdzzfsleg
cycle
0
epoch
0
period
72
block
145593
offset
712374975
timestamp
2011-09-16 14:14:25 UTC
rarity
common
prev
next